copyright UK: Understanding the Illegal Market
The increasing risk of copied cards in the UK represents a serious issue for individuals and payment institutions alike. This unlawful market involves criminals stealing card data – often through sophisticated methods like data theft at ATMs or point-of-sale terminals, or through data breaches – and then producing fake cards. These sham cards are subsequently employed to make unauthorized transactions, resulting in financial harm for both cardholders and lenders. The authorities are vigorously working to tackle this crime and defend the public from its detrimental effects but vigilance from all parties is essential to reduce the harm caused by such underground.

British Clone Plastic Card Schemes : Protecting Your Finances from Deceptive Practices
The emergence of sophisticated UK copyright programs poses a serious danger to consumers. These illegal operations involve criminals generating copy credit and debit plastic cards using compromised details. To safeguard you , it’s essential to stay vigilant. Periodically check your credit provider's statements for suspicious activity and quickly notify any discrepancies. Be wary of scam emails or text messages requesting card numbers and never disclose such sensitive data over unreliable channels. Finally, be conscious of your surroundings when employing your payment card at ATMs and stores .
